Course Overview

Gateway English Course 4 is an ELICOS (English Language Intensive Courses for Overseas Students) program classified under the Non AQF Award level. It belongs to the field of education 091501 - Language and Literature, focusing on English language skills. The course is offered by Curtin University, a public university based in Bentley, Western Australia. With over 1,556 CRICOS-registered providers in Australia offering more than 26,000 courses, this program stands out as a pathway to further academic study at Curtin or other Australian institutions. Students gain practical English skills in reading, writing, listening, and speaking, preparing them for success in an English-speaking academic environment.

Fees (Indicative)

The indicative tuition fee for Gateway English Course 4 is A$13,000, with no non-tuition fees listed, bringing the estimated total to A$13,000 as per the CRICOS register. Please note that this does not include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C), living expenses (estimated at A$21,000–A$30,000 per year depending on lifestyle and location), or the student visa application charge. OSHC is mandatory for international students. For current fees, always check Curtin University's official website, as fees are set by the institution and subject to change.

Student Visa Information

International students need a Student visa (Subclass 500) to study this course. You must meet the Genuine Temporary Entrant (GTE) requirement, have sufficient financial capacity for tuition, living costs, and dependents, and maintain OSHC. Student visa holders can work 48 hours per fortnight during term and unlimited hours during scheduled breaks. It is crucial to comply with visa conditions.
